Microsoft’s two-way folding device patent exposed

Microsoft has previously launched a folding device with a dual-screen design, the Surface Duo. Although the phone does not use a folding screen, as the first work of Microsoft to return to the mobile phone market, the Surface Duo still attracts many people with its unique appearance. Gaze.

   Recently, the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) announced a new patent from Microsoft. The patent shows that Microsoft will create a brand new double-folding device through a folding screen. The device has two hinges, which can be transformed into a folding screen mobile phone that can be grasped with one hand after being folded, and it can also be transformed into a larger device when it is unfolded.

   There are also media speculations that Microsoft’s patent is for the “foldable tablet computer” as a technical reserve. Once the processor and key components are readily available, folding tablets will also enter the market.
   Regrettably, Microsoft has not announced more details. But judging from this patent, it seems that Microsoft will also bring some novel devices to users through “folding screens.” Of course, what brand-new experience can be brought to users through the double-folding design?
